Here's the other problem I have with making KMZ's directly from OGR.
Often, users will want to include auxiliary files for icons, etc in the
kmz archive. As soon as we start zipping KML output I'm worried we'll
have to introduce some provision to include these files in the final
output....

*) Google's libkml is not yet production ready
  

Fair enough - I haven't used it. But my hope would be that if Google is
going to be using this in Google Earth then it should get up to speed
pretty darn quickly. Of course, I'm not sure they've said that...




*) Once the KML 2.2 spec is approved by OGC I expect it to be rather
stable, so I'm not sure that switching to libkml for an evolving
standard is really going to buy OGR much.
  


Another good point. To be honest my interest is more in seeing the few
flaws I've discovered fixed than anything else. If it's easier to fix
the current driver then that's probably the way to go.




*) It would probablybe trivial to add kmz support, but as Brian
suggested why not just pipe the file to a zip command?
  


Well, that's fine if you're just trying to lash something together
specifically for KML files on a linux system, but not so great if you're
developing, say, commercial windows software that has to deal with lots
of different formats. As I see it the whole point of an abstraction
layer like GDAL/OGR is that you shouldn't have to care about the
intricacies of particular data formats. So if your users are going to be
trying to load KMZ files (the Google Earth default format) into your
application, it would be much nicer if OGR could just do its job and
read those files without you having to special case things. No?
